Output 8df7acee23e52eb4dbb91d3594023b870640d5b920fb153cb14b3ff5dddc0e34:0

value
162558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5369a63fc31ca20ec117e963c3092ee97611601 OP_EQUAL
address
3Q3atRy66qQp1dek2SHVJjwvGVqh8JtR1G
transaction
8df7acee23e52eb4dbb91d3594023b870640d5b920fb153cb14b3ff5dddc0e34
spent
true